Machine Learning Could Accelerate Coronavirus Research

Artificial intelligence is seeing increasing use in the field of medicine. Machine learning (ML) has the capability to analyse massive amounts of complex data, extracting information at a speed otherwise unattainable by humans.

ML has been used to identify promising drugs and analyse research papers. Now, the White House’s Office of Science and Technology Policy is urging researchers to use ML to analyse coronavirus articles, of which there are approximately 29000. This could help answer important questions about the origins of the virus, which could in turn aid in the development of treatments and a vaccine.

To achieve this goal, the White House office has partnered with Microsoft and Google to produce a database of coronavirus articles, which now contains around 13000 full entries, the remainder being partial texts.
